Small business owners are bracing for a steep rise in health-care costs next year as enhanced premium tax credits set to expire at the end of this year. Bloomberg's Caitlin Reilly discussed the impact on "Bloomberg Markets" with Scarlet Fu. (Source: Bloomberg)
